Austin serial killer rumors grow after body found in Lady Bird Lake – MySA

A body was recovered near Lady Bird Lake on the morning of Saturday, April 13, which has rekindled theories of the Rainey Street Killer.

Read More at Source.

Pumilo
Author: Pumilo